iLEAD Online TK-8th Graders, Join Small Group Sessions, Win Prizes!
We are pleased to offer small group sessions designed to help your child succeed. Starting this semester, we’re making our small group interventions and instruction even more rewarding! For every small group session your child attends, they’ll receive an entry into a monthly raffle to win exciting prizes!
We believe that small group sessions are a valuable resource for all learners, and we encourage you to motivate your child to attend. Here’s how you can help:
-
Contact your child’s academic coach for specific meeting times.
-
Talk to your child about the benefits of attending small group sessions, including personalized support with class work, time to learn and have fun with friends, and boosting skills and confidence.
-
Encourage your child to participate actively and ask questions.
-
Celebrate your child’s attendance!
We’re confident that small group sessions will make a positive impact on your child’s learning journey. We look forward to seeing them level up!
